The University of Cincinnati community is mourning the tragic and unexpected loss of freshman football player Jeremiah Kelly, who passed away early Tuesday at his residence. The university’s athletic department confirmed the heartbreaking news but did not disclose a cause of death. The Cincinnati Police Department has not yet provided additional information.

Jeremiah Kelly, just 18 years old, had already made a significant impression on his coaches, teammates, and the greater Bearcats family in the short time since his arrival on campus. Standing 6-foot-3 and weighing 320 pounds, Kelly was a standout offensive lineman from Avon, Ohio, where he had recently helped lead Avon High School to an undefeated 16-0 season and a 2024 state championship title. His leadership and talent on the field were matched by his character and work ethic off it, earning him the respect and admiration of everyone he encountered.

“The Bearcats football family is heartbroken by the sudden loss of this outstanding young man,” head coach Scott Satterfield said in a statement. “In the short time Jeremiah has spent with our team, he made a real impact, both on the field and in our locker room. My prayers are with the Kelly family and those who had the pleasure of knowing Jeremiah.”

Kelly was an early enrollee at Cincinnati, taking part in spring practices and quickly demonstrating that he had a bright future ahead in college football. Known for his infectious energy, warm smile, and unwavering dedication, Jeremiah quickly became a favorite among teammates and coaches alike.

“We’ve suffered a heartbreaking loss today,” said Cincinnati athletic director John Cunningham. “All of us at UC send our love and prayers to the Kelly family, and we will do everything that we can to support them and our Bearcats student-athletes in the difficult days and weeks ahead.”
